Belo Medical Group’s new Neurocosmetics line explores how stress, emotions and the nervous system influence skin reactions, and offers treatments designed to calm both mind and complexion

Skin has long been treated as a surface concern, yet science increasingly points to its complex dialogue with the brain. Stress, fatigue or anxiety can trigger breakouts, redness and sensitivity—responses that traditional treatments sometimes fail to address. Recognising this, Belo Medical Group has developed a new line of treatments that integrate neurological science into skincare: Belo Neurocosmetics.

The concept is simple yet innovative. By targeting the mechanisms that connect mental and emotional states to skin function, Belo Neurocosmetic treatments work beyond superficial effects. They aim to restore balance, reduce inflammation and strengthen the skin’s resilience against both internal and external stressors.

Dr Vicki Belo, whose practice has shaped aesthetic medicine in the Philippines for 35 years, emphasises the scientific foundation behind the new line. “Belo Neurocosmetics influences what triggers skin inflammation, and helps your skin stay calm and quiet,” she explains. The approach is consistent with Belo Medical Group’s long-standing philosophy of combining innovation with evidence-based protocols, from lasers to skin boosters and signature surgical procedures. “We’ve always believed in science-backed beauty,” says Dr Belo.

The Neurocosmetics lineup addresses a range of needs. The NeuroGlow Facial is designed for acne-prone, oily or sensitive skin, offering a balanced, radiant finish without the harshness of traditional facials or peels. The NeuroLift Facial targets tired or stressed skin, delivering lifting and firming effects with visible improvements in tone, texture and elasticity, all without downtime.

For deeper cellular revitalisation, the NeuroRepair Treatment employs ExoComplex®️, PRP and bioactive peptides to promote collagen production and overall resilience. Those concerned with pigmentation can turn to the NeuroBright Treatment, which targets melasma, dark spots and post-acne marks while maintaining the integrity of the skin barrier. Even the delicate under-eye area has a solution in NeuroBright Eyes, a quick, non-invasive treatment that refreshes tired, puffy or dark circles in under 20 minutes.
